Orient Overseas (International) Ltd. (OOIL) is a Hong Kong-based container transport and logistics services company with operations in over 85 countries and regions. It has an annual revenue of over $6 billion. OOIL was founded in 1947 by Tung Chao-yung.
Operating China’s first international merchant fleet since 1947, OOIL capitalised on the advent of container transport in 1969, taking delivery of the largest containership ever built in 2017.
At the time of the company founder’s death in 1982, OOIL managed a fleet of over 140 ships. Tung’s sons, Tung Chee Hwa and Tung Chee Chen, ran the company until its acquisition by COSCO Shipping Holdings Company Limited in 2018.
The high-profile, $6.3 billion acquisition made COSCO the world’s third-largest container shipping line.
